Definition & Synonyms
|
• Mislead
- (v. t.) To lead into a wrong way or path; to lead astray; to guide into error; to cause to mistake; to deceive.
Synonyms: Misguide, Misinform,
|
• Misleader
- (n.) One who leads into error.
|
• Misleading
- (a.) Leading astray; delusive.
- (p. pr. & vb. n.) of Mislead
Synonyms: Deceptive,
